一、安装Docker Desktop
Docker Desktop是适用于Windows的Docker桌面应用,专为Windows 10设计。它是一个本地Windows应用程序,提供易于使用的开发环境,使您可以轻松构建、交付和运行Docker化的应用程序。
要在Windows 10上安装Docker Desktop,请遵循以下步骤:
- 在Docker官网上创建一个账号并下载Docker Desktop。确保下载适用于Windows的版本。
- 安装完成后,启动Docker Desktop。您可以在开始菜单中找到它,或者在命令提示符下输入“docker”来启动。
- 确保Docker Desktop已成功启动并正在运行。您可以在命令提示符下输入“docker version”来检查是否已成功连接Docker守护进程。
二、使用Docker命令安装vim编辑器
一旦您已经安装并运行了Docker Desktop,您可以使用Docker命令在容器中安装vim编辑器。以下是安装步骤: - 打开命令提示符或PowerShell窗口,并确保您已连接到Docker守护进程。输入“docker ps”来检查正在运行的容器。
- 使用以下命令创建一个基于Ubuntu的容器,并在其中安装vim编辑器:
docker run -it --name mycontainer ubuntu:latest /bin/bash
这将创建一个名为“mycontainer”的新容器,并在其中启动一个交互式会话。 - 在容器中执行以下命令来更新软件包列表并安装vim编辑器:
apt-get update && apt-get install vim
- 等待安装完成。一旦安装完成,输入“exit”退出容器。
- 现在您可以使用以下命令列出正在运行的容器,并找到您刚刚创建的容器:
docker ps -a
找到您的容器后,记下其容器ID或名称。 - 使用以下命令进入容器的交互式会话:
docker exec -it <container_id_or_name> /bin/bash
替换“”为您的容器的ID或名称。这将使您能够与容器内的vim编辑器进行交互。 - 现在您可以在容器中使用vim编辑器了。输入“vim”命令即可启动vim编辑器。您可以在其中打开、编辑和保存文件,就像在常规Linux系统上一样。
通过以上步骤,您已经在Windows 10上成功搭建了Docker Desktop开发环境,并使用Docker命令在容器中安装了vim编辑器。现在您可以开始使用Docker和vim进行开发工作。请记住,每次需要进入容器时,只需重复步骤6即可进入交互式会话并使用vim编辑器。